Your receive settings appear to be correct since they agree with http://www.shaw.ca/en-ca/CustomerCar...ePOPAccess.htm However, note the sentence on that page that says "...does not allow you to send and upload email directly from your computer from a non-Shaw computer connection" I don't know why you are getting a receive error. It sounds like something that is unique to Shaw. Have you tried to do what it suggests, first login via webmail? Sheila, what you experienced is normal. As a general rule, the owner of the SMTP server must be the same as the one providing your Internet connection at that moment. For more on this see http://www.postcastserver.com/help/P..._Blocking.aspx The available workarounds for sending away from home are as follows: 1. Use webmail for sending (via your browser). 2. If you use the same away-from-home connection frequently, substitute the SMTP server belonging to that connection. This is a bit tricky, but if you want to go that route, I can provide more details. 3. If you frequently send from multiple locations, get a free Gmail account, configure it for POP access, and use it for your sending chores.
